Port Indexes

The interface index must be used for port designations. The following table shows how the
interface indexes are assigned to the ports.

Important private MIB variables of an IE Switch X-200
OID The private MIB variables of the IE Switch X-200 have the following object identifier:
iso(1).org(3).dod(6).internet(1).private(4).enterprises(1).
ad(4196).adProductMibs(1).simaticNet(1).iScalanceX(5).iScalanceX200(2)

Description
The number of different interfaces available in the component.
Possible values: 4 - 8
A description and possibly additional information for a port. Possible
value: string with a maximum of 255 characters
The value ethernet-csmacd(6) or optical(65) is entered for
SCALANCE X-200.
Data transfer rate of the Ethernet port in bits per second. With
SCALANCE X-200 devices, this is either 10 Mbps or 100 Mbps
The current operating status of the Ethernet port. The following values
are possible: ● up(1) ● down(2)
Length of time for which the selected port has been operating in the
current status. The value is shown in hundredths of a second.
Number of received packages that were not forwarded to higher protocol
layers because of an error.
Number of packages that were not sent because of an error.
